33-35-14. Administration of deposits of plans.

Any deposits of a sponsor of a prepaid legal services plan deposited with the Commissioner pursuant to this chapter shall be administered by the Commissioner in accordance with Chapter 12 of this title as though deposited by a domestic casualty, life, or accident and sickness insurer authorized to transact insurance in this state or as deposited by a corporation authorized to transact business in this state pursuant to Chapter 18 or 19 of this title.

(Code 1933, § 56-3521, enacted by Ga. L. 1975, p. 1268, § 1; Ga. L. 1983, p. 748, § 7.)
